‘Green’ Businesses Recognized By Color in Ohio
Photo courtesy hibino and licensed by Creative Commons.
Liberal Columbus, Ohio Mayor Michael B. Coleman has stepped up the city’s “Get Green Columbus” program by recognizing businesses that have made an effort to become more environmentally friendly. Coleman hopes that potential customers will patronize those establishments asking that residents “support them, buy from them, visit them and thank them.” I’m sure the expense each business has incurred to make themselves more green is passed on to the customers. Will these higher prices drive consumers to lower-priced alternatives?
